Job Summary: Leads the planning, designing, purchasing, and implementation of changes to the manufacturing equipment and systems while leading and co-leading teams.   Key Responsibilities: Leads the work for specific projects to create and implement all aspects of a manufacturing processes to ensure safety requirements, manufacturing goals, business goals, and product specifications are met. Leads by applying the knowledge or use of manufacturing principles and practices to improve manufacturing equipment and processes. Impacts the work by utilizing continuous improvement tools, following the Cummins standards, and leading the development of manufacturing standards and working methods. Leads the communications with and influences key external stakeholders, business leaders, and functional members. Works with internal and external resources on specific project assignments. Leads the advanced knowledge of manufacturing principles and practices as they are applied to Cummins. Maintains relationships and coaches key stakeholders. Cummins is an equal opportunity employer.
